高效液相色谱-离子阱-飞行时间质谱鉴定决明子化学成分  被引量:32

Components identification in Cassiae Semen by HPLC-IT-TOF MS

摘  要:目的:建立高效、准确鉴定决明子中化学成分的液质联用方法。方法:采用高效液相色谱-离子阱-飞行时间质谱(HPLC-IT-TOF MS)联用技术,在电喷雾离子源的正、负离子模式下,以甲醇-乙腈(21)混合溶液(A)-水(B)梯度洗脱,流速为1.0 m L·min-1,柱温为35℃。根据决明子的一级和二级质谱图,对比对照品保留时间并结合文献,推测化合物可能的裂解途径和结构。结果:通过分析各组分质谱数据,共鉴别了17个化合物,包括7个萘并吡喃酮类化合物、7个蒽醌类化合物和3个萘酚类化合物,其中有决明子内酯龙胆二糖苷为首次从该植物中发现。结论:采用IT-TOF MS技术有利于新化合物的发现和鉴别,为中药化学成分、质量控制研究提供了新内容。Objective:To develop a facile method for identification of components in Cassiae Semen by HPLC-MS. Methods:The method was performed on HPLC-IT-TOF MS with electrospray ionization in both positive and negative ion modes with the mobile phase of mixed solution of methanol and aeetonitrile in proportion 2 : 1 (A) -water (B) by gradient elution. The column temperature was at 35 ℃ and the flow rate was 1.0 mL . min - 1. According to first and multi-stage mass spectrum diagrams, retention time of standard materials and published reports, the components in Cassiae Semen were identified and their fragmentation pathways were concluded. Results: A total of 17 components were identified, including 7 naphthopyrones, 7 anthraquinones and 3 naphthols. Among them, cassia- lactone gentiobioside was found for the first time in Cassiae Semen. Conclusion : The application of IT-TOF MS in determining components in TCM is useful and will provide essential data for further research.
